Team — the Hushwire alert deduplicator ships to production tonight. For our new contractor: dedup windows now default to five minutes, and suppressed alerts still appear in the audit view, so nothing is silently dropped. Please review the rollout notes before your first shift. The deploy is traceable via the identifier listed below.

session token of kageg-tahop = htk14_af3c1ccccb7dcf

# Sievewell CSV import wizard — contractor notes.
# The wizard stages every uploaded file in a temp table before any
# validation runs, so malformed rows never touch production data.
# Column mappings are saved per-tenant and versioned; do not edit
# mapping rows by hand, use the admin tool. Rejected rows are kept
# for 14 days for customer review. All staging and mapping tables
# live in the database identified by the connection string below.

replica DSN, kajep-yahag: mssql://praok_svc:iF@db-8d68.plorvaio.local:5432/eliion

Hey Dara — quick handover. The master key set for the Larchwell warehouse is in the red pouch in the key safe. Bryn from Oakhurst Couriers is picking it up around 14:00 to run it to the Pellam Street annex. Sign the log first, obviously. Before handing over the pouch, give Bryn this phrase:

courier memo of yahif-faweg: the quenael tamius courier leaves the prawyn jorix kaswyn istox silmir brieth zormir fenvan ledger at gate 3145 under passcode 231062

### Step 4: Localize date formats

Before promoting the Meridio 5.1 build, switch all user-facing date rendering from the hardcoded formatter to the new locale-aware Datewright module. Verify the six supported locales render correctly on the settings screen, paying particular attention to right-to-left layouts. Any screen still using the legacy formatter will log a deprecation warning. The locale service ships with the following configuration defaults.

deployment values, yahag-tawef:
ZORWYN_HOST=zorwyn.tolvaqlabs.internal
ZORWYN_PORT=9300